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6354113511 721609804 940560 0484 83312
121832519 8178 328
121832519 8178 328
714 982132 43347369 659
All about undefined
Interested in learning more?
121832519 8178 328
714 982132 43347369 659
See more
377 16 2822189778
55 15198 73543 139469957 7724
See more
907639 110060885
335793 3226699129 194800343
See more